This is a treasured sake that has been aged for 10 years, using Sekiya Brewery's signature product "Kuu." It is aged at low temperatures. Please enjoy the wide range of flavors that combine the umami of rice and a gentle aroma while retaining the good qualities of ginjo sake.

A bowl-shaped sake cup is recommended to bring out the sake's umami and sweetness. Earthenware and porcelain cups match well, too.
